Removing vinyl stickers or in this case stripes involves heat. You need to warm the the area the needs to be removed with a blow dryer. Start at one end and warm from the top. Not too hot just warm. Then get the edge lifted up and peel gently. Once you have some of it up use the blow dryer on the back side and follow along as you pull gently. Do not rush the process. Removing takes time. This should work on all things vinyl if not clear coated over.

I went out on a hot day after the car had been sitting in the sun and just picked at one corner til it came up, then a steady pull and they came right off. Including cleaning some adhesive off with bug & tar remover, it took all of 5 minutes to take all 6 pieces off.
